Xbox 360 price drops in Australia

Microsoft has announced that the popular gaming and entertainment console will now be available from just AU$199.

Just after the release of a new look, lower cost PlayStation 3, Microsoft has announced a price drop across its whole range of Xbox 360 devices.

The console will now start at just AU$199 for the 4GB model, and up to AU$299 for the 250GB version. The Kinect has also dropped, losing AU$50 off its price for an RRP of AU$149.

Limited-edition consoles will now cost AU$399, although this only applies to pre-existing packs, not to upcoming limited-edition releases, such as the Halo 4 bundle.

The new pricing comes into effect on Thursday, 4 October.

The full price list:

  • Kinect Sensor, AU$149 (save AU$50)

  • 4GB Xbox 360, AU$199 (save AU$50)

  • 4GB Xbox 360 with Kinect, AU$299 (save AU$100)

  • 250GB Xbox 360 AU$299 (save AU$150)

  • Limited edition consoles AU$399 (save AU$50).
